Adam Kownacki out to make statement on Fox Main Event

Greg Leon: You're headlining on Fox August 3rd against Chris Arreola. It will be your first headline on Fox, tell us about it. Adam Kownacki: "Keep stepping up you know, slowly but surely... I guess they finally realized that when I fight, people leave after my fight, so they made me the headliner. Greg Leon: In other words if they want the fans to stick around, you've got to fight last. Adam Kownacki: "Definitely. This is going to be a great card too, you've got Marcus Browne fighting (Jean) Pascal, Andre Berto is also making his comeback and he hasn't fought in a while, so this is going to be a good card."
 
GL: Is this a fight you'll win impressively?
 
AK: "I hope so, I have to. I was able to knock out Szpilka and Gerald Washington faster than Wilder did and I want to be able to say I got Arreola out of there faster than Wilder did."
 
GL: What are your thoughts of him as a fighter?
 
AK: "He's a warrior, he comes to fight and it should be fun."
 
GL: What did you think about the recent shocker with Andy Ruiz upsetting Anthony Joshua?
 
AK: "It was crazy, the heavyweight division is very exciting right now. I was shocked with that result, I knew Ruiz had fast hands and I knew he was game, but for him to beat him like that was crazy."
 
GL: How do you feel about your good friend Jarrell Miller blowing the opportunity of a lifetime against Anthony Joshua?
 
AK: "It sucks. For him it must be even tougher, knowing what Ruiz was able to do with a similar style."
 
GL: [WBC heavyweight champion Deontay] Wilder's fighting Luis Ortiz next and then talking about the Tyson Fury rematch after that. It's starting to look like you might not get your shot until next year at this time, are you content with that?
 
AK: "Winning against Arreola will get me one step closer. You never know what's going to happen in boxing, you saw what just happened with Ruiz and Joshua. In boxing anything is possible, all I could do is continue to train hard, continue winning and doing what I have to do."
 
GL: Do you regret not jumping on the opportunity to fight Anthony Joshua when the fight was presented to you?
 
AK: "No. I wasn't prepared to take the fight with him, so it is what it is."
 
GL: Closing thoughts.
 
AK: "I'm ready to go and I can't wait to get back in the ring."
